1

顧客が注文したときに記事を含むテーブルの情報を変更したい、つまり、テーブル PEDIDO_ARTICULO に行が挿入されたときに、残りの製品数の情報を減らす必要があります。テーブルARTICULOSの更新ステートメントを使用したトリガーで考えた場合、次のようになります。

--Actualizamos las unidades disponibles del articulo
UPDATE ARTICULO A
SET A.UnidadesDisp = A.UnidadesDisp - v_unidades_pedidas + v_unidades_devueltas
WHERE A.Color= :NEW.Color AND A.Talla=:NEW.Talla AND A.CodigoP=:NEW.CodigoP;

そのようにUnidadesDispを自己参照することは可能ですか?

4

0 に答える 0